Output 66e50370d818c7ba02376991ac6e2ab559bcdad66a2c495cbeca8053ad3e84a8:8

value
5032
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e04f423fcd121973c7495d31e11eeb07f9910e9434636b280a3a7b139bb36e45
address
bc1pup85y07dzgvh836ft5c7z8htqluezr55x33kk2q28fa38xandezs7kve6q
transaction
66e50370d818c7ba02376991ac6e2ab559bcdad66a2c495cbeca8053ad3e84a8
spent
true